OpenClaw(龙虾)在宝塔怎么接入工作流一步一步教学
2026-03-19 2
详情
报告
跨境服务
文章
引言
OpenClaw(龙虾)是一个面向开发者与自动化运维场景的开源低代码工作流引擎,支持通过可视化编排实现任务调度、API集成、数据处理等逻辑。它不依赖特定平台,但需部署在服务器环境(如Linux+Web服务)中运行;宝塔是国产Linux服务器管理面板,用于简化Nginx/Apache、PHP/Python、数据库等服务配置。

要点速读(TL;DR)
- OpenClaw不是宝塔原生插件,需手动部署为独立服务(如Python Flask应用),再通过宝塔反向代理或端口映射暴露访问入口;
- 接入核心步骤:服务器准备→源码部署→依赖安装→服务启动→宝塔反代配置→工作流调试;
- 无需购买授权,但需具备基础Linux命令、Python环境及HTTP反向代理认知;
- 适合有自建自动化需求的跨境卖家(如订单同步、库存校验、多平台API聚合)。
它能解决哪些问题
- 多平台API手动调用效率低 → OpenClaw可编排Shopee、Lazada、TikTok Shop等平台API调用链路,自动完成订单拉取→状态更新→物流回传;
- 定时任务分散难维护 → 替代crontab,统一在Web界面配置定时触发逻辑(如每小时同步ERP库存);
- 跨系统数据桥接缺失 → 作为中间层连接Shopify Webhook、MySQL数据库、企业微信机器人,实现事件驱动式响应。
怎么用:OpenClaw在宝塔接入工作流(6步实操)
以下基于Ubuntu 22.04 + 宝塔7.9+ + Python3.10环境(其他组合请以OpenClaw官方文档为准):
- 确认服务器环境:宝塔已安装并运行,开放非80/443端口(如8080),Python管理器已启用对应版本;
- 上传OpenClaw源码:从GitHub官方仓库下载最新Release包(如v0.8.2),解压至
/www/wwwroot/openclaw目录; - 安装依赖:进入该目录,在宝塔终端执行:
pip3 install -r requirements.txt(确保pip源可用,建议换清华源); - 启动服务:执行
python3 app.py --host 0.0.0.0 --port 8080;验证是否可访问http://服务器IP:8080; - 配置宝塔反向代理:站点设置→反向代理→添加,目标URL填
http://127.0.0.1:8080,缓存关闭,SSL按需配置; - 首次登录与工作流创建:访问域名(如
claw.yourshop.com),默认账号admin/admin,新建Workflow,拖拽HTTP Request节点调用平台API,保存后启用。
费用/成本影响因素
- 服务器资源占用(CPU/内存):工作流并发数、节点复杂度直接影响;
- 是否启用持久化存储:使用SQLite默认库无额外成本,切换PostgreSQL需单独部署;
- 是否集成第三方认证(如OAuth2):需自行申请平台Client ID/Secret,不产生OpenClaw费用;
- 是否定制开发节点:超出内置HTTP/DB/Script节点需编写Python插件,开发成本由自身承担。
为了拿到准确部署成本,你通常需要准备:预期并发量、日均工作流执行次数、是否需高可用(双机热备)、是否已有Python运维能力。
常见坑与避坑清单
- 端口被宝塔安全组拦截:启动前务必在宝塔「安全」→「放行端口」中添加8080(或自定义端口);
- 依赖安装失败因pip版本过旧:先执行
pip3 install --upgrade pip再装requirements; - 反代后前端静态资源404:检查OpenClaw配置中
STATIC_URL_PATH是否与反代路径一致,推荐保持根路径(/); - 工作流无法触发定时任务:确认后台进程未被系统OOM Kill,建议用Supervisor守护(宝塔软件商店可一键安装)。
FAQ
OpenClaw(龙虾)在宝塔怎么接入工作流一步一步教学:靠谱吗?是否合规?
OpenClaw为MIT协议开源项目,代码完全公开,无闭源模块或后门;其运行不涉及平台接口违规调用,合规性取决于你配置的工作流逻辑是否符合各电商平台API使用条款(如请求频次、数据用途)。建议阅读Shopee/Lazada开发者协议中关于自动化调用的限制条款。
OpenClaw(龙虾)在宝塔怎么接入工作流一步一步教学:适合哪些卖家?
适合具备基础技术理解力的中大型跨境卖家或运营团队:已使用ERP/自建系统、需打通多平台API、有Python或Shell脚本经验;纯小白无服务器操作经验者不建议直接上手,可先用宝塔部署测试站练手。
OpenClaw(龙虾)在宝塔怎么接入工作流一步一步教学:常见失败原因是什么?如何排查?
最常见失败原因:① 反向代理未开启「Websocket支持」导致控制台连接中断;② 工作流中HTTP节点未设超时(默认30s),遇平台响应慢即报错;③ 宝塔Python项目管理器未指定正确解释器路径。排查建议:查看app.log日志、浏览器F12 Network标签看请求状态码、终端执行netstat -tuln | grep 8080确认端口监听状态。
结尾
OpenClaw在宝塔接入本质是「服务部署+反代暴露」,无黑盒,可控性强,但需动手能力。
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

